3.0 out of 5 stars Fine addition to series, January 21, 2007
By 
This review is from: The Buffs (Men-at-Arms) (Paperback)
This is a well written comprehensive look at the history of one of the oldest serving regiments in the British Army. This book was out of print for 30 years before Osprey issued a special reprint in 2002.

5.0 out of 5 stars One Tough Old Outfit, July 1, 2005
By 
D. D Lawson (Pasadena, Calif. USA) - See all my reviews
(REAL NAME)   
This review is from: The Buffs (Men-at-Arms) (Paperback)
Another example of the early Ospreys in that they either have great illustrations or great text but almost never both. This one is a great history of the 3rd Regiment of foot that had its start under Queen Elizabeth I. To its history of service to the Dutch and its final return to service under the Crown. It is here that the Regiment really blossumed. Its story then became the story of the Empire until its final disbandment.
A great story!
